Output 239b0b6cb7c55d21efe309c9048e77bfd8f5b025ff54c3ead15e813c45d49b02:30

value
178938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bffc01e2ab8304c9febef2a45a7f5c8723aaafa1 OP_EQUAL
address
3KC8sxkaqbWWFEPJNuLXu7Su7XSntzhDZC
transaction
239b0b6cb7c55d21efe309c9048e77bfd8f5b025ff54c3ead15e813c45d49b02
confirmations
165217
spent
true